The Padres' Struggles: A Spiraling Descent

San Diego's baseball team, once a force to be reckoned with, finds itself in a downward spiral. The Padres' losing streak has extended to six games, and their offensive woes have become a pressing concern. With a collective batting average of .215, they are mired at the bottom of the league in all three slash categories. This decline is particularly striking, as strong pitching has typically been their strength. However, the lack of hitting is now catching up to them, and the team's record stands at a concerning 1-10 over an 11-game stretch. The Padres' struggles serve as a reminder that baseball is a delicate balance of offense and defense, and their current situation highlights the importance of a well-rounded team.

Freeman's Walkoff Heroics: A Dodgers Triumph

In a display of clutch hitting, Freddie Freeman etched his name in baseball history. With a solo home run in the bottom of the ninth inning, Freeman secured a 1-0 victory for the Dodgers over the Angels. Since 1920, only five players have amassed more walkoff hits than Freeman, who now boasts an impressive 20 career game-ending hits. This achievement is even more remarkable when considering the stellar pitching performance of Roki Sasaki. Sasaki, who had struggled earlier in the season with a 5.88 ERA, delivered seven shutout innings, striking out 10 batters. His recent turnaround, with a 1.48 ERA over his last four starts, underscores the transformative power of resilience and adaptability in baseball.

Braxton's Battle: A Rising Star in the Braves' Realm

In the heart of Atlanta, a captivating pitching matchup unfolds. Spencer Strider, a standout performer for the Braves, faces off against Braxton Ashcraft, a rising star for the Pirates. While Paul Skenes rightfully earns the nod as Pittsburgh's ace, Ashcraft has emerged as a formidable talent. With a 2.77 ERA, a 27.3% strikeout rate, and a 5.7% walk rate over 74 2/3 innings, Ashcraft is establishing himself as a force to be reckoned with. His performance against the league-leading Braves will be a true test of his mettle, as the Braves, with a 43-21 record, continue to dominate the National League. This matchup exemplifies the beauty of baseball's unpredictability, where rising stars can challenge established powers and shape the course of the season.
